Congestion on the M25 between J29 and Tilbury/ Baker Street Interchange after crash near Dartford

There are severe delays on the M25 due to an accident involving a lorry and a crane.

Traffic is queuing for nine miles on the M25 clockwise following an earlier accident which happened after J1A A206, for Dartford.

There is congestion between J29 (Romford/ Basildon) and Tilbury/ Baker Street Interchange on the A13 Westbound approach.

The travel time is around an hour and a half.

The vehicles involved have been removed and lane closures removed.
